A woman in Naivasha is calling on the government to intervene in a case where a group of people have allegedly threatened to grab her land.
Esther Wanjiku Kagechi of Munyaka farm South lake region in Naivasha said her life is in danger following threats by a group of people alleged to be behind a plot to grab the piece of land.
"My plight has been unheard for long. Together with my children, I hardly sleep since these people are always trying to send us away. These grabbers have been attacking me, beating me together with my children and are now planning to demolish my home to scare me away," she said.
"They have been forcibly tilling the land which I legally own and now want to take it away, the only place I have known as my property for years,” Wanjiku said.
According to her, unscrupulous land dealers sold the piece of land to a buyer lately without following the right procedure.
She has now reported the matter to the area chief and is waiting for response which she says should be expedited before she is forced out of her home.
“They want to force themselves in a place they don’t own. They bought it from some land brokers ignoring the fact that there were some rightful owners. I do not have anywhere to go with my children. I do my farming here which is my only source of livelihood. I urge the government to step in and help me because I have all the evidence and documents of ownership to prove that I own the land,” Wanjiku said.
